Inaugurati­on ceremony for Maui County Council scheduled to go virtual

Judge Hamman will officiate the Jan. 2 swearing-in event

-

The Maui County Council will hold a virtual inaugurati­on ceremony Jan. 2, Chairwoman Alice Lee announced Wednesday.

The ceremony will take place at 10 a.m. via the BlueJeans online platform to comply with social distancing guidelines and allow equal access to the live event for Maui County residents, Lee said.

Judge Kirstin Hamman will officiate the swearing-in ceremony for the members of the 2021-23 council:

≤ Gabe Johnson, Lanai residency seat.

≤ Tasha Kama, Kahului. ≤ Kelly Takaya King, South Maui.

≤ Alice Lee, Wailuku-Waihee-Waikapu.

≤ Michael Molina, MakawaoHai­ku-Paia.

≤ Tamara Paltin, West Maui. ≤ Keani Rawlins-Fernandez, Molokai. ≤ Shane Sinenci, East Maui. ≤ Yuki Lei Sugimura, Upcountry.

Kumu Kapono‘ai Molitau will open the ceremony with an oli and pule, Lee said. Retired Battalion Chief Louis Romero and firefighte­rs Ikaika Blackburn and Jerry “Pito” Javier will lead out the national anthem and “Hawai‘i Pono‘i.” Kathy Collins will be master of ceremonies.

Following the inaugurati­on, the council will hold its organizati­onal meeting at 2 p.m. to elect officers, establish standing committees, adopt rules and appoint staff. Mayor Michael Victorino will preside over the meeting until the council selects its chairperso­n for the new term.

The public can view the inaugurati­on and organizati­onal meeting on Akaku channel 53, mauicounty.us/agendas and facebook.com/mauicounty council.
